Transaction 740bf474df3d089af60a3aee5f9ac09b27c8d129a840399100f7c12a9ac630a3

3 Input
2 Outputs
  • 740bf474df3d089af60a3aee5f9ac09b27c8d129a840399100f7c12a9ac630a3:0
  • value  2514389
    address  15kFE7RMg2Q59AsvhRxmGYcPjrqf3iqD11
  • 740bf474df3d089af60a3aee5f9ac09b27c8d129a840399100f7c12a9ac630a3:1
  • value  600000000
    address  18c57sKFL1gjNMr5eAVnAozUkUqoKPB8w6